Pacific Gem and Bobek are popular bittering hops. Below you'll find a comparison of alpha and beta acids, aroma profiles and oil composition.

Key differences

When to pick Pacific Gem

  • Higher alpha acid - stronger bittering
  • Higher beta acid - smoother, longer-lasting bitterness
  • Richer, more complex aroma profile

When to pick Bobek

  • More essential oils - more intense aroma

Property

PropertyPacific GemBobek
Alpha acid13–15%3.5–9.3%
Beta acid7–9%4–6.6%
Co-humulone35–40%26–31%
Total oil0.8–1.6 mL0.7–4 mL
Myrcene30–40%30–45%
Humulene20–30%13–19%
Caryophyllene6–12%4–6%
Farnesene0–1%4–7%
OriginNew ZealandSlovenia
PurposeBitteringBittering
